まえきんブログ

2024/2/11~ WordPress版ブログへお引越ししました🖊(詳細はトップページ記事をご参照頂ければと存じますm(_ _)m)

【Excel VBA学習 #105】日付で絞り込む Part1

まえきんです!

今回は日付で絞り込む(Part1)について学習しましたのでご紹介します。

f:id:maekinblog:20210620144830p:plain

今回は日付で絞り込むマクロを考えます。

簡易的にマクロの実行ボタンを作成して、上記のコードを

実行すると下記のように結果が得られます。

【実行前】

f:id:maekinblog:20210620144924p:plain

【実行後】

f:id:maekinblog:20210620144942p:plain

1列目について、「2021/6/20」の行のみが絞り込まれていることが確認出来ました!

絞り込みの条件として文字列を指定するこのコードは、Excelのバージョンによって

指定方法が異なるようです。Excel2007/2003では文字列指定はできず、引数には

「DateValue("2021/6/20")」と関数を使うか、日付リテラルの「#06/20/2021#」と

しなければ同じ結果は得られないそうです。そこは注意が必要ですね!

次回#106は「日付で絞り込む Part2」VBAコードについて学習予定です。

最後まで読んで頂きありがとうございました!ではまた!